.DocsSearch_searchWrapper__9Fpib{padding:0 12px 16px;font-family:system-ui,-apple-system,sans-serif}.DocsSearch_searchButton__muBze{display:flex;align-items:center;gap:8px;width:100%;padding:0 12px 0 14px;background:#fff;border:1px solid #e4e4e7;border-radius:12px;color:#6b7280;font-size:14px;font-weight:400;line-height:24px;height:36px;cursor:pointer;transition:border-color .15s ease,box-shadow .15s ease}.DocsSearch_searchButton__muBze:hover{border-color:#cbd5e1;box-shadow:0 1px 3px rgba(0,0,0,.04)}.DocsSearch_searchButton__muBze svg{flex-shrink:0}.DocsSearch_searchIconButton__dWPKt{background:none;border:none;padding:6px;margin-right:-6px;color:#52525b;cursor:pointer;display:flex;align-items:center;justify-content:center}.DocsSearch_searchIconButton__dWPKt:hover{color:#18181b}.DocsSearch_searchLabel__6vpAj{flex:1 1;text-align:left}.DocsSearch_shortcut__7akIP{flex-shrink:0;font-size:10px;padding:2px 5px;background:#f1f5f9;border-radius:4px;color:#64748b}.DocsSearch_overlay__YUnJN{position:fixed;inset:0;background:rgba(15,23,42,.6);-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);z-index:100;display:flex;align-items:flex-start;justify-content:center;padding-top:15vh}.DocsSearch_modal__mVbNS{width:100%;max-width:560px;background:#fff;border-radius:12px;box-shadow:0 25px 50px -12px rgba(0,0,0,.25);overflow:hidden;max-height:70vh;display:flex;flex-direction:column;font-family:system-ui,-apple-system,sans-serif}.DocsSearch_searchInputWrapper__a_EZ9{display:flex;align-items:center;gap:12px;padding:16px 20px;border-bottom:1px solid #e5e7eb}.DocsSearch_searchInputWrapper__a_EZ9 svg{flex-shrink:0;color:#94a3b8}.DocsSearch_searchInput__YO2VJ{flex:1 1;border:none;outline:none;font-size:16px;color:#0f172a;background:rgba(0,0,0,0)}.DocsSearch_searchInput__YO2VJ::placeholder{color:#94a3b8}.DocsSearch_closeButton__UcXTQ{padding:4px 8px;background:#f1f5f9;border:none;border-radius:4px;color:#64748b;font-size:12px;cursor:pointer;transition:background .15s ease}.DocsSearch_closeButton__UcXTQ:hover{background:#e2e8f0}.DocsSearch_results__n4KLa{flex:1 1;overflow-y:auto;padding:8px;min-height:100px}.DocsSearch_noResults__t6PbH{padding:40px 20px;text-align:center;color:#94a3b8;font-size:14px}.DocsSearch_emptyState__OLizF{padding:32px 20px;text-align:center;color:#94a3b8;font-size:13px}.DocsSearch_emptyState__OLizF .DocsSearch_emptyHint__IfJ56{margin-bottom:16px;color:#64748b}.DocsSearch_emptyState__OLizF .DocsSearch_emptyKeys__jT9bZ{display:flex;flex-wrap:wrap;justify-content:center;gap:12px}.DocsSearch_emptyState__OLizF .DocsSearch_emptyKeys__jT9bZ span{display:inline-flex;align-items:center;gap:4px}.DocsSearch_emptyState__OLizF .DocsSearch_emptyKeys__jT9bZ kbd{padding:2px 6px;background:#f1f5f9;border-radius:4px;font-size:11px}.DocsSearch_resultItem__c6eWL{display:block;padding:12px 16px;border-radius:8px;text-decoration:none;color:#334155;transition:background .15s ease}.DocsSearch_resultItem__c6eWL.DocsSearch_active__DudII,.DocsSearch_resultItem__c6eWL:hover{background:#f1f5f9}.DocsSearch_resultTitle__X8R_T{font-size:14px;font-weight:600;color:#0f172a;margin-bottom:4px}.DocsSearch_resultPath__DtIq8{font-size:12px;color:#94a3b8}.DocsSearch_resultExcerpt__PmR2L{font-size:13px;color:#64748b;margin-top:4px;display:-webkit-box;-webkit-line-clamp:2;line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}.DocsSearch_highlight__qXplF{background:#fef08a;padding:0 2px;border-radius:2px}.DocsSearch_footer__KwCFN{padding:12px 16px;border-top:1px solid #e5e7eb;display:flex;align-items:center;gap:16px;font-size:12px;color:#94a3b8}.DocsSearch_footerKey__k201D{display:inline-flex;align-items:center;gap:4px}.DocsSearch_footerKey__k201D kbd{padding:2px 6px;background:#f1f5f9;border-radius:4px;font-size:11px}.DocsSidebar_sidebar__9y9R1{width:256px;min-width:256px;height:100%;border-right:1px solid #e4e4e7;padding:16px 0;overflow-y:auto;overflow-x:hidden;background:#fff;font-family:system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;z-index:1;flex-shrink:0;scrollbar-width:thin;scrollbar-color:#d4d4d8 rgba(0,0,0,0)}.DocsSidebar_sidebar__9y9R1::-webkit-scrollbar{width:4px}.DocsSidebar_sidebar__9y9R1::-webkit-scrollbar-track{background:rgba(0,0,0,0)}.DocsSidebar_sidebar__9y9R1::-webkit-scrollbar-thumb{background:#d4d4d8;border-radius:2px}.DocsSidebar_sidebar__9y9R1.DocsSidebar_mobileMode__f4wiV{width:100%;min-width:0;border-right:none}.DocsSidebar_logoLink__G6Stq{display:flex;align-items:center;gap:8px;padding:0 16px 16px;text-decoration:none;cursor:pointer}.DocsSidebar_logoLink__G6Stq:hover .DocsSidebar_logoText__4BASK{color:#0ea5e9}.DocsSidebar_logoText__4BASK{font-size:18px;font-weight:600;line-height:20px;color:#111827;transition:color .15s ease}.DocsSidebar_subtree__jUxFf,.DocsSidebar_tree__jYO62{list-style:none;padding:0;margin:0}.DocsSidebar_subtree__jUxFf{margin:4px 0 0 16px}.DocsSidebar_item__B6Ka9{margin:0}.DocsSidebar_row__PRr34{display:flex;align-items:center;gap:8px;padding:6px 12px;border-radius:6px;margin:0 8px 2px;transition:background .15s ease,color .15s ease}.DocsSidebar_row__PRr34:hover{background:#f4f4f5}.DocsSidebar_row__PRr34.DocsSidebar_active__yIw6P{background:#dbeafe}.DocsSidebar_row__PRr34.DocsSidebar_active__yIw6P .DocsSidebar_link__0C1_C{color:#0284c7;font-weight:600}.DocsSidebar_row__PRr34.DocsSidebar_topLevel__rFPz_{padding:8px 12px;border-radius:6px;margin-bottom:0}.DocsSidebar_row__PRr34.DocsSidebar_topLevel__rFPz_ .DocsSidebar_label__uSMLR,.DocsSidebar_row__PRr34.DocsSidebar_topLevel__rFPz_ .DocsSidebar_link__0C1_C{font-weight:500;color:#18181b;font-size:14px;line-height:20px}.DocsSidebar_row__PRr34:not(.DocsSidebar_topLevel__rFPz_) .DocsSidebar_label__uSMLR,.DocsSidebar_row__PRr34:not(.DocsSidebar_topLevel__rFPz_) .DocsSidebar_link__0C1_C{font-weight:400;color:#52525b;font-size:14px;line-height:20px}.DocsSidebar_toggle__Tz3IL{display:flex;align-items:center;justify-content:center;width:20px;height:20px;border:none;background:none;color:#a1a1aa;cursor:pointer;padding:0;flex-shrink:0;margin-left:auto;transition:transform .15s ease}.DocsSidebar_toggle__Tz3IL.DocsSidebar_open__lHiFL{transform:rotate(90deg)}.DocsSidebar_link__0C1_C{text-decoration:none;line-height:20px;flex:1 1}.DocsSidebar_link__0C1_C:hover{color:#0284c7}.DocsSidebar_label__uSMLR{line-height:20px;flex:1 1;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;user-select:none}.MobileDocsHeader_mobileHeader__G4n_d{display:none;align-items:center;justify-content:space-between;height:64px;padding:0 20px;background:#fff;border-bottom:1px solid #e4e4e7;position:-webkit-sticky;position:sticky;top:0;z-index:40}@media(max-width:768px){.MobileDocsHeader_mobileHeader__G4n_d{display:flex}}.MobileDocsHeader_logoLink__rBp4N{display:flex;align-items:center;gap:8px;text-decoration:none}.MobileDocsHeader_logoText__8jySL{font-size:18px;font-weight:600;color:#111827}.MobileDocsHeader_burgerButton__J4TRA{background:none;border:none;padding:6px;margin-left:-6px;color:#52525b;cursor:pointer;display:flex;align-items:center;justify-content:center}.MobileDocsHeader_burgerButton__J4TRA:hover{color:#18181b}.MobileDocsHeader_overlay__kQfxG{position:fixed;top:0;left:0;right:0;bottom:0;background:rgba(0,0,0,.4);z-index:50;display:flex;flex-direction:column}.MobileDocsHeader_drawer__EBhOe{background:#fff;width:280px;max-width:80vw;height:100%;display:flex;flex-direction:column;animation:MobileDocsHeader_slideIn__saTGB .3s cubic-bezier(.16,1,.3,1) forwards}@keyframes MobileDocsHeader_slideIn__saTGB{0%{transform:translateX(-100%)}to{transform:translateX(0)}}.MobileDocsHeader_drawerHeader___k2Im{display:flex;align-items:center;justify-content:space-between;padding:20px;border-bottom:1px solid #e4e4e7}.MobileDocsHeader_drawerTitle__F1u0f{font-size:16px;font-weight:600;color:#111827}.MobileDocsHeader_closeButton__yWJM1{background:none;border:none;padding:6px;margin-right:-6px;color:#52525b;cursor:pointer}.MobileDocsHeader_closeButton__yWJM1:hover{color:#18181b}.MobileDocsHeader_drawerContent__doiUv{flex:1 1;overflow-y:auto;display:flex;flex-direction:column}.MobileDocsHeader_drawerContent__doiUv>nav{width:100%!important;min-width:0!important;border-right:none!important}.layout_container__Q90ya{width:100%;height:100vh;display:flex;overflow:hidden;background:#fff;font-family:system-ui,-apple-system,sans-serif}.layout_sidebarSlot__x7_6C{flex-shrink:0;overflow:hidden;display:flex;width:256px;min-width:256px;height:100%}@media(max-width:768px){.layout_sidebarSlot__x7_6C{display:none}}.layout_main__jRf6j{flex:1 1;min-width:0;overflow-y:auto;overflow-x:hidden;padding:0;display:flex;flex-direction:column}